サーバーの監視を行うのに大金をかける必要はありませんし、貴重なリソースを大量に消費することもありません。Beszelは軽量でオープンソースのサーバーモニタリングダッシュボードで、CPU、RAM、ディスクI/O、ネットワークの指標を複数のマシンから一つのWebインターフェースで追跡することができます。512MBのRAMだけで快適に動作するため、ほとんどすべてのVPSプランが適していますが、長期的なデータ保持やマルチサーバー展開には適切な選択が重要です。
Beszelとは?
Beszelは、シンプルなダッシュボード、SQLiteバックエンド、小さなエージェントバイナリを各監視サーバーに展開することで構成されるセルフホスト型の監視ソリューションです。ハブはポート8090で動作し、Dockerまたはスタンドアロンバイナリを使用して展開可能です。NetdataやUptime Kumaに似ていますが、サービスのヘルスチェックではなくシステムのメトリックに焦点を当てています。
最小要件:512 MB RAM、1 vCPU、5 GBストレージ。
推奨:1 GB RAM、1 vCPU、10 GBストレージ。
Beszel用VPS選定時に考慮すべき要素
- RAM:Beszelだけなら512MBで十分ですが、1GBあると他のサービスも併せて実行可能です。
- ストレージ:SQLiteのメトリックは時間とともに蓄積されるため、多サーバー構成には10GB以上が快適です。
- ネットワーク:監視対象サーバーとの低レイテンシーにより、エージェントのポーリング遅延を抑えられます。
- 場所:EU拠点のプロバイダー(Hetzner、Contabo)を選べば、GDPRコンプライアンスが強化され、ヨーロッパインフラに対するレイテンシも低減します。
- 価格:Beszelは非常に軽いため、計算リソースに過剰に費やす必要はありません。
VPS比較表
| プロバイダー | 価格 | vCPU | RAM | ストレージ | おすすめ用途 |
|---|---|---|---|---|---|
| Contabo VPS | 5.99 EUR/月 | 4 | 8 GB | 200 GB NVMe | 最もストレージが多く、EU準拠 |
| Hetzner Cloud | 4.15 EUR/月 | 2 | 4 GB | 40 GB NVMe | EU内で最良の価格/パフォーマンス |
| DigitalOcean | 6 USD/月 | 1 | 1 GB | 25 GB SSD | 初心者向け設定に最適 |
| Vultr | 6 USD/月 | 1 | 1 GB | 25 GB SSD | グローバル32拠点展開 |
| Linode (Akamai) | 5 USD/月 | 1 | 1 GB | 25 GB SSD | 信頼性の高いグローバルネットワーク |
推奨VPSソリューション
Contabo VPS - マルチサーバーモニタリングのコストパフォーマンス最良
価格:5.99 EUR/月 | 4 vCPU、8 GB RAM、200 GB NVMe
Contaboは、ストレージあたりのコストが最も優れています。多数のサーバーを監視し、SQLiteで数か月分のメトリック履歴を保持したい場合、200GBのNVMeドライブで楽に対応できます。8GB RAMも、他のサービス(リバースプロキシ、アラートツール、二次監視スタックなど)を同時にホスティングする余裕を与え、リソース圧迫を防ぎます。
長所:
- 市場で最良のストレージコスト。
- 8 GB RAMでBeszelと複数の補助サービスを同時に運用可能。
- GDPR準拠のためのEUデータセンター選択肢。
Hetzner Cloud - ヨーロッパ内で最高の価格性能比
価格:4.15 EUR/月 | 2 vCPU、4 GB RAM、40 GB NVMe
HetznerのCX22インスタンスは、4GB RAMと高速NVMeストレージを最安値で提供しています。HetznerのAPIやTerraformプロバイダーは一流で、監視対象の増加に伴うVPSの自動展開も容易です。多くのBeszel展開、例えば20〜30台のサーバー監視にはこのプランで十分です。
長所:
- 正当なEU提供者として最安のNVMeストレージ付きプラン。
- 優れたAPIとインフラとしてコードのサポート。
- ドイツとフィンランドのデータセンターによる安定した稼働。
DigitalOcean - 初心者向け最適
価格:6 USD/月 | 1 vCPU、1 GB RAM、25 GB SSD
DigitalOceanの$6 Dropletは、Beszel推奨の1GB RAMを正確に備えており、業界でもトップクラスの導入体験を提供します。ドキュメント、マーケットプレイス、サポートチャネルは、セルフホストされた監視設定の初心者にとって非常に使いやすいです。ワンクリックのDockerインストールにより、初期設定時間を大幅に短縮できます。
長所:
- 優れたドキュメントと初心者に優しいUI。
- マーケットプレイスからのワンクリックDockerセットアップ。
- 管理済みデータベースやバックアップも簡単に追加可能。
よくある質問
Beszelには実際にどのくらいのRAMが必要ですか?
Beszelは最小512MBのRAMで動作しますが、推奨は1GBです。10〜30台のサーバーを監視する専用の監視VPSには1〜2GBのRAMが快適です。Beszelを他のコンテナと併用する場合は、適宜リソースを割り当ててください。
最も安いVPSでもBeszelは動きますか?
はい。Beszelは非常に軽量なため、512MBまたは1GBのRAMを持つVPSでもハブとして十分に機能します。監視対象サーバーにインストールされるエージェントはごく少量のリソース(通常10MB未満)しか消費しません。
複数の大陸にサーバーを分散して監視している場合、どのVPSが最適ですか?
Vultrは32か所のグローバルロケーションにより、重要なサーバーの近くにBeszelハブを配置できるため優れた選択肢です。または、EUまたはUSの中央拠点から運用しても良いでしょう。エージェントのポーリングは軽量で、遅延に対して寛容です。